Siding dirt removal services involve cleaning away accumulated soil, mud, and debris that can build up on the exterior surfaces of a property’s siding. Over time, dirt and grime can settle into the textures and crevices of various siding materials, making a home look dull and neglected. Professional dirt removal typically uses high-pressure washing or gentle cleaning techniques suited to the siding type, ensuring surfaces are thoroughly cleaned without damage. This service helps restore the appearance of the home’s exterior, making it look fresh and well-maintained.

Dirt buildup on siding can lead to a range of problems if left unaddressed. It can trap moisture against the surface, increasing the risk of mold, mildew, and algae growth, which can cause staining and deterioration over time. Additionally, accumulated dirt can obscure the true condition of the siding, hiding potential issues like cracks or damage that may need repairs. Regular dirt removal can help prevent these problems, extending the lifespan of the siding and maintaining the property’s cur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Siding Dirt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Clearwater,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or dirt removal from siding usually range from $150 to $400.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and extent of dirt buildup.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Medium-Sized Projects - For larger areas or more persistent dirt, local contractors often charge between $400 and $1,000. These jobs are common for homeowners seeking a thorough cleaning of larger siding sections.

Extensive Cleaning - Deep cleaning or multiple-story siding dirt removal can cost between $1,000 and $2,500. Projects in this range tend to be less frequent but are necessary for heavily soiled exteriors or extensive surfaces.

Full Siding Restoration - Complete dirt removal and preparation for siding replacement typically start around $2,500 and can exceed $5,000 for large or complex properties. Larger, more involved projects are less common but may be needed for significant restoration efforts.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is siding dirt removal? Siding dirt removal involves cleaning the exterior surfaces of a building's siding to eliminate dirt, grime, and other buildup, enhancing curb appeal and protecting the material.

Why should I consider siding dirt removal? Regular siding dirt removal can improve the appearance of a property, prevent potential damage caused by dirt accumulation, and maintain the value of the home or building.

What types of siding can local contractors clean? Contractors can typically clean various siding materials such as vinyl, wood, fiber cement, and aluminum, using appropriate cleaning methods for each type.

How do professionals typically remove dirt from siding? They often use gentle pressure washing, specialized cleaning solutions, or hand scrubbing to effectively remove dirt without damaging the siding.
